Transaction 82698182340e1dc79a34b7ca2ab1ea4f1d5b46d21b56be358e96b9993d5019f3
1 Input
1 Output
-
82698182340e1dc79a34b7ca2ab1ea4f1d5b46d21b56be358e96b9993d5019f3:0
- value
- 133460618
- script pubkey
- OP_0 OP_PUSHBYTES_20 88bf50d92cad06880729a3834d89beb11e52eae1
- address
- bc1q3zl4pkfv45rgspef5wp5mzd7ky0996hptwtnl9